Speed Capabilities

Speed is a critical factor when selecting a modem. The 2026 models support the latest Wi-Fi standards and DOCSIS technology, ensuring high-speed connectivity.

Xfinity XB7

The XB7 supports speeds up to 1.2 Gbps, making it suitable for most households with multiple devices and streaming needs. It features DOCSIS 3.1 technology, which provides faster data transfer and better network efficiency.

Xfinity XB8

The XB8 enhances speed capabilities, supporting up to 2 Gbps. It is ideal for heavy internet users, online gaming, and 4K streaming. Its advanced hardware ensures minimal latency and reliable performance.

Xfinity XB9

The top-tier XB9 offers speeds up to 3 Gbps, designed for ultra-high-demand households. It includes the latest Wi-Fi 6E technology, providing broader coverage and higher throughput for numerous connected devices.

Pricing and Value

The price of each modem varies based on features and performance. Here’s a breakdown of the approximate costs:

  • Xfinity XB7: $199 – $249 (retail)
  • Xfinity XB8: $299 – $349 (retail)
  • Xfinity XB9: $399 – $449 (retail)

These prices may vary depending on promotions, rental options, or bundling with other services. Renting from Xfinity often includes maintenance and updates, which can be cost-effective for some users.
